Aragon Partners with Katana to Launch vKAT Network-Level Tokenomics

**Aragon announced vKAT**, a network-wide tokenomics system for Katana's DeFi-first rollup that captures value at the chain level rather than individual protocols. **Key features of vKAT:** - Sustainable yield for token holders - Enhanced liquidity for applications - Value flows back to the network itself **Aragon's infrastructure includes:** - Lockers and gauges for emissions - Automated relayers for participation - Governance hub within Katana's app Aragon CEO discussed **separating governance from execution** to build more modular and resilient onchain organizations. This represents a shift from protocol-level ve models to network-wide value accrual systems. The partnership demonstrates how tokenomics can be embedded directly into rollup infrastructure, creating sustainable growth loops for entire ecosystems rather than individual DeFi protocols.

Aragon Introduces Custom Proposal Types for DAOs

Aragon app now enables organizations to create customized proposal types for different governance needs. Key features include: - Specialized flows for treasury, grants, upgrades, and membership - Configurable voting thresholds and multi-stage approvals - Veto windows and timelocks - Role-based permissions The modular system allows organizations to implement tailored governance without coding. Aragon Launches Value Accrual Toolkit with veTokens and Gauges

Aragon has introduced its Value Accrual Toolkit, featuring two key components: - **veLocker System**: Implements time-weighted voting power through token locking, encouraging long-term commitment - **Gauges**: Enables token holders to direct capital allocation and emissions through voting The toolkit aims to bridge the gap between governance and value creation in onchain organizations. Key features include: - Customizable lock durations and voting power - Resource allocation across predefined categories - KPI-based payouts and bribe markets - Analytics and optimization tools Currently managing $35B+ in assets across 10,000+ organizations.
